  • Patent number: 11813128
    Abstract: Embodiments disclose a disposable protective assembly apparatus for a dental syringe body of a dental syringe. The apparatus is a combination of a disposable syringe tip and a disposable protective sleeve, the sleeve being pre-attached to the syringe tip, and the sleeve being in a pre-folded position to be quickly and easily slid over the dental syringe prior to a dental operation.

  • Patent number: 9795464
    Abstract: A dental syringe device that provides air and water to a dental patient. The device includes an adapter that connects a dental tip to a dental syringe body. The dental syringe body provides a conventional syringe body with a handle for a dentist to hold onto and a source of air and water. The tip delivers the air and water to the dental patient. The adapter is an improved adapter having a unique release and attachment component allowing for a quick connect and disconnect between the dental syringe body and the tip. The tip advantageously includes an inner portion with large and uniform air channels for smooth transfer of air and an outer portion made from a rigid plastic that provides an improved cheek retraction feature.

  • Publication number: 20150079539
    Abstract: A dental mixing device with a barrel, a mixing tip, and a plunger. The plunger moves dental material through the barrel where it is mixed using a mixing tip. The mixing tip includes an auto-aligning fitting female element configured to align with an auto-aligning fitting male element of the barrel. This auto-alignment simplifies the attachment between the mixing tip and the barrel. The mixing tip also includes a seal component with a soft material (or component) to insert into the auto-aligning fitting element which is a hard material (or component) to achieve seal. The seal component and auto-alignment fitting element can be combined together into one component instead of two components.

  • Patent number: 8212818
    Abstract: Development environments are commonly used to facilitate the development of user interfaces (e.g. windows forms, web forms, etc.). Drawing objects are components that may be used within the development environment to provide visual enhancements to the user interface. An effective method for drawing one or more drawing objects is disclosed herein to draw the drawing objects as windowless shapes within a shape container. The shape container may be configured to participate in a windows message loop (e.g. event handling system), wherein the windowless shapes do not participate in the windows message loop (e.g. lack a windows handle). The shape container listens, for example, within the windows message loop for operations pertaining to windowless shapes, and executes the operations upon the windowless shapes. Computer resources may be efficiently allocated, for example to the graphical user interface during runtime, instead of the windowless shapes consuming resources to participate in the windows message loop.
